Overview
A type definition for some HL7v2 type (incl. Segments and Datatypes).

Instance Attribute Details
#fields ⇒ Array<Google::Apis::HealthcareV1::Field>
The (sub) fields this type has (if not primitive).
Corresponds to the JSON property fields
4277 4278 4279 |
# File 'lib/google/apis/healthcare_v1/classes.rb', line 4277 def fields @fields end |
#name ⇒ String
The name of this type. This would be the segment or datatype name. For example,
"PID" or "XPN".
Corresponds to the JSON property name
4283 4284 4285 |
# File 'lib/google/apis/healthcare_v1/classes.rb', line 4283 def name @name end |
#primitive ⇒ String
If this is a primitive type then this field is the type of the primitive For
example, STRING. Leave unspecified for composite types.
Corresponds to the JSON property primitive
